Joe Dent, 53, was identified as the inmate who died in the Douglas County Jail on Wednesday. Douglas County Coroner Randy Daniel said although the autopsy is not back yet, the death was from natural causes and not suspicious.

Daniel said Dent weighed about 400 pounds and had a pacemaker. He also had chronic kidney disorder and was diabetic.

Because he died in custody, an autopsy is mandated by the State, Daniel said, and although the results may not be known for several weeks, the determination will be heart-failure related. "He was in bad shape," Daniel said.
